Conservatory Windows

A conservatory is a popular way to add more space to your home, and to allow you to enjoy your garden throughout the year, even when it is cold and wet! Having great windows in your conservatory is important for a few reasons. First of all, you want to be able to see out clearly so you can enjoy the views from your room. Conservatory windows can sometimes end up misting up in between the panes, or condensation can be an issue. New conservatory windows will allow you to have a clear line of sight once again. Another key reason to ensure your conservatory windows are up to scratch is that of a security point. The windows on your conservatory could become an easy target for break ins, as older styles are not always as secure as the modern standard of glazing. Our windows are all secure, with locking systems and limits on opening to help prevent people from breaking into your home. The third reason windows are important for your conservatory is for keeping the temerature more stable. Old Windows often let heat out quickly, which is not ideal in the colder months. They are also prone to heating up too much in the summer, which can make the Conservatory too hot to sit in and enjoy. A Veranda and Terrace Canopy are two words implying the same thing; An extension to a house covering an outside area. Or a roof supported by two posts, made of aluminium with a polycarbonate roofing.

A glass room refers to an 'uninsulated' house extension in the shape of a terrace canopy or veranda equipped with (glass) (sliding) doors so that the area can be fully closed. Architecturally, a glass room is not part of the house.

A glass room looks like a conservatory, but the main differences is that a conservatory refers to an insulated extension of the house. So this is an actual part of a house, making it more expensive and complicated to buy and install a conservatory.

You will only need planning permission if your Veranda Glass Room is over 3m  in height, or is located on the roof of your home or it will be larger than 50% of the land that the original house covers.

Adding a glass door system to an existing canopy at a later moment is no problem at all. 

A Veranda requires little maintenance. We do recommend however to clean the Veranda about twice a year. In addition to the fact that your Veranda looks better without dirt, it also increases the lifespan of the Veranda. 

When cleaning your Veranda, we recommend using a sponge or a soft cloth. You can easily clean the aluminium frame with water and a neutral soap.

The polycarbonate roofing can be cleaned in the same way, but be extra careful. Don't forget to frequently keep the gutter free from leaves and dirt to prevent the water drain from getting clogged.

Yes we do provide a silicone seal where required e.g. where the side frames touch the house walls. The main reason for these seals is to ensure the finish is aesthetically pleasing. It's rare for a house wall to be perfectly straight so it's important to use a seal which takes up the small gaps between the wall and the aluminium frames. The seals will help to keep draughts out too however it's beneficial from a ventilation point of view for these spaces not to be completely sealed. 

The lip under the sliding doors is approximately 25mm tall, with a requirement that the track which the doors sit on must be level. In most instances the patio that we are bolting onto is not perfectly level. The first step is to effectively pack and raise the track in any low areas of the patio base to ensure you get a decent level of protection from water running into the veranda. We then apply a trim over this packaging to ensure it looks ascetically pleasing. It is common for a patio to intentionally slope with a fall way from the home to the garden.
